So, everyone and their mom -- I think literally -- has been telling me, "Oh, Sheila, read Lois McMaster Bujold, you'll really like her 'cause of x, y, z, and the other nine million things what you like that you have rambled on about forever." And so, failing to find the first Vorkosigan book, I picked up Paladin of Souls, found it immensely dull, and then promptly never picked up another book by her. I mean, I tried other things, like, uh, not-the-first-book-in-the-Vorkosigan-series, found it dull, and then failed to pick it up again.

Then, in a fit of Oh God, I'm Bored and That Robin Hobb Book Made Me Want to Punch Someone in the Face and I've Already Read Both Vampire Assassins for the CIA books, I picked up The Sharing Knife: Beguilement, liked it immensely, picked up The Sharing Knife: Legacy, liked it a little less, and was still utterly consumed by boredom. So then, thinking maybe my bad experience with Paladin of Souls was because I'm a freak who HAS TO READ THE FIRST BOOK OMG, I picked up Curse of Chalion and I liked it! I mean, pretty much it had the stuff I liked. Like good people! kickass women! interesting musings on the nature of religion! queerness! politics! sacrifice! more sacrifice! the bizarre twistings of fate! honorable people doing the best they can to walk the edge between cool pragmatism and integrity!

And so I still have Paladin of Souls to read and Amy told me to read Nancy Farmer and it is all pretty much entirely with the yay.
